- Abstract: An approach to the specification of the dynamics of changes in the values of quality indicators, which characterize the decision support process for security event and incident management, is proposed. The approach is based on analyzing the processes of cyber attack detection and prevention and analyzing the decision support processes for managing the structure, parameters and work modes of detection and prevention systems. It also uses controlled Markov chains in the form of difference stochastic equations. The considered mathematical representation of the state change dynamics allows one to formalize and structure the specification of this type process taking into account its requirements for operativeness (timeliness), validity (veracity), secrecy and resource costs.
